Tracy Material Recovery&Transfer Station SPCC Plan <br /> This SPCC Plan must be amended whenever there is a change in facility design, construction, <br /> operation or maintenance, and must be reviewed at a minimum of every five years (40 CFR <br /> §112.5). As a result of this review and evaluation, TMR will amend the SPCC Plan within six <br /> months of the review to include more effective pollution control technology in the event that: <br /> • Such technology will significantly reduce the likelihood of a spill event from the Facility;and, <br /> • Such technology has been field proven at the time of review. <br /> Management reviews of this SPCC Plan must be documented using the form provided in <br /> Appendix 3. <br /> Any technical amendment to the SPCC Plan shall be certified by a Professional Engineer within <br /> six months after a change in the Facility design,construction,operation,or maintenance occurs <br /> which materially affects this Facility's potential for the discharge of oil into or upon the navigable <br /> waters of the United States or the adjoining shorelines. A Professional Engineer certification is <br /> not required for non-technical amendments such as changes to phone numbers,names,etc. <br /> NOTE:This SPCC Plan will be reviewed and re-certified no later than October, <br /> 2024 or within six months in the event of a change in facility design, <br /> construction, operation, or maintenance.
